WebMethod 2: Using the paragraph dialog box. There are the following steps to create a hanging indent using paragraph dialog box-. Step 1: Open the Word document. Step 2: Select the paragraph where you want to create a hanging indent. Step 3: Go to the Home tab on the Ribbon and click on the Show the Paragraph dialog box in the Paragraph group.
